Abstract

2,4-dihydroxy-5-acetylacetophenone(DAAP), 2,4-dihydroxy-5-acetylacetophenone dihydrazone (DAAD), and 4,6-Bis-(1-[(4,6-dichloro-[1,3,5]-triazine-2-yl)-hydrazono]-ethyl)-benzene-1,3-diol (BDTHEBD) as starting materials were synthesized and characterized by physical and spectral studies.4,6-Bis-(1-[(4,6-disemicarbazino-[1,3,5]-triazine-2-yl)-hydrazono]-ethyl)-benzene-1,3-diol (BDSTHEBD) was prepared by the reaction of 4,6-Bis-(1-[(4,6-dichloro-[1,3,5]-triazine-2-yl)-hydrazono]-ethyl)-benzene-1,3-diol(BDTHEBD) with semicarbazide hydrogen chloride in a 1:4 molar ratio in ethanol/methanol/nitromethane(being 1:1:8). The synthesis of complexes with transition metal (II) ions (Co2+and Ni2+) were undertaken and the resulting complexes were characterized by 1H NMR, IR, UV-Vis, and AAS spectroscopic techniques. In addition, thermal analysis, Magnetic susceptibility, conductivity measurements and chloride estimation were also through. Syntheses of the metal complexes were carried out using methanol/triethyl amine (being 1:5) mixture as a solvent. Analytical results reveal that the complexes have 1:4 ligand and metal ratio. Furthermore, based on spectroscopic results (NMR, IR, UV-Vis, and AAS), analytical data and Magnetic moments, enolization and deprotonation of BDSTHEBD were concluded. Four chelating sequences per ligand (NNN, NNO, NNO, and NNN) were identified through which four metal ions (Co2+ and Ni2+) were coordinated. Subnormal magnetic moments at room temperature suggest metal-metal interactions in the complexes. Octahedral geometry was proposed for the complexes.
